Crye Replicas: Should I go with Claw Gear or Emerson?
11 August, 2014, 19:12
Hello, I have a friend after some trousers with built in knee pads, Crye style. If given the choice between Emerson and Claw Gear, what should he go for? We're not after the best replica of Crye but the best quality trousers. What say you?!

Re: Crye Replicas: Should I go with Claw Gear or Emerson?
emerson all the way,
my whole team have emerson and myself and my best mate have been running it for some time... originally the AU atacs, we now have moved onto the AOR2.
Gen 1 trousers have rigid kneepads which arent as comfortable to kneel down on, but ultimately do protect your knee, but the recent generation of knee pads are 'self inserts' so they come uninstalled and in the packet, they are held in by small velcro rectangles which do the job fine... its the glue holding the velcro to the pads which loses the will to live (or so i have experienced) im going to buy some Kevlar thread or similar and sew the velcro on, then after that i would have to say the emerson trouser, short of the real deal, are the best ive ever worn.
hope this helps

Re: Crye Replicas: Should I go with Claw Gear or Emerson?
The Emerson trousers are a bargain for the money. However quality wise are nowhere near as good as claw gear. They are however cheaper. The gen 3 replicas would last a bit longer as the elastic panels have been removed as they tended to rip and fray. I've had loads of pairs of Emerson trousers and value for money, them or TMC you can't go wrong.
